
The Importance of a Renters Insurance Policy’s Liability Coverage
When you first hear the term “renters insurance,” you might initially think about how the right policy can help you financially protect your belongings. However, these policies are often multifaceted and can include additional coverages beyond repairing or replacing your personal possessions. One particularly crucial aspect of renters insurance to familiarize yourself with is its personal liability coverage.
What Is Personal Liability Coverage?
Similar to the liability coverage in a homeowners or personal auto insurance policy, this aspect of renters insurance can help offset losses and expenses arising from incidents affecting third parties for which you’re at fault. A third party typically refers to anyone not a member of your household, such as a neighbor, guest or passerby.
Who Is Covered by My Liability Coverage?
Your renters insurance policy can cover incidents involving multiple members of your household, including your spouse, roommates, children and even pets. You should verify who is covered when purchasing or renewing your policy, as this could affect your premiums and other aspects of your coverage. For example, children and certain dog breeds may increase your perceived risk levels and incur higher costs.
Why Is This Coverage Important?
If you’re at fault for someone else’s losses, it can lead to expensive consequences. Consider the following scenarios:
- You invite guests over, but someone slips on a wet spot in your kitchen and their injuries require medical attention. Fortunately, your liability coverage may help offset resulting bills and limit out-of-pocket costs.
- Your children are riding their bicycles outside, and one loses control and crashes into a parked car. In this situation, your renters insurance could help pay for repairing the vehicle.
